Paragraph on Vishwakarma Puja in 100-150 Words / Essay on Vishwakarma Puja in 100 Words

Students can find below a paragraph of Vishwakarma Puja in 100-150 words or essay on Vishwakarma Puja in 100 words:


Vishwakarma, the god of architecture and engineering, is offered puja in the month of September by most of the industrial houses, artists and weavers.

According to mythology, the whole universe including earth and heaven are created by Vishwakarma. The credit for inventing Vajra and other weapons of early civilization goes to Vishwakarma. Vishwakarma is regarded as the supreme worker, the very essence of excellence and quality in craftsmanship.

Vishwakarma is also the creator of sciences of industry to man. The shops, workshops, industries or factories are cleaned and decorated to welcome the deity Lakshmi. Thenprasad is distributed among the visitors. The yearly feast is cooked and served to both workmen as well as owners. Children also celebrate the day by flying kites throughout the day. Vishwakarma Puja is an inspiration for many to create new products and increase productivity for the working class.


Paragraph on Vishwakarma Puja in 200-250 Words / Essay on Vishwakarma Puja in 200 Words

Students can find below a paragraph of Vishwakarma Puja in 200-250 words or essay on Vishwakarma Puja in 200 words:


Visvakarman is the divine architect of the universe, the personification of creative power which ‘welds heaven and earth together’.

Visvakarman not only represents supreme creative power but also universal knowledge and wisdom. He is both the establisher (dhatar) and the disposer (vidhatar). Satapatha Brahmana (XIII. 7, 1f) mentions that Visvakarman performed a universal sacrifice (Sarvamedha) in which he offered up all creatures and finally himself.

This sacrifice was believed to be particularly efficacious and to give supremacy over all creatures. This ‘dis­memberment of the lord of creatures, which took place at that archetypical sacri­fice, was in itself the creation of the universe, so every sacrifice is also a repetition of that first creative act.

Thus the periodical sacrifice is nothing else than a microcosmic representation of the ever-proceeding destruction and renewal of all cosmic life and matter. But Visvakarman’s importance was superseded by the notion of the eternal Self-Existent Principle (brahman). Finally he appears as the mythical founder of the science of architecture (vastuvidya).

Visvakarman Puja has been declared by the Government of India on a particular day, i.e., 17th of September, considering the secular tone of the celebra­tion. According to Hindu tradition, it is observed on Sravana Light half 5 and still most of the Lohars (Iron-smith) and Barhai (Carpenters, etc., celebrate it is their houses. On mass scale, smaller industrial units celebrate it on 17th of September.


Paragraph on Vishwakarma Puja in 300 Words / Essay on Vishwakarma Puja in 300-500 Words

Students can find below a paragraph of Vishwakarma Puja in 300-500 words or essay on Vishwakarma Puja in 300 words:


The birthday of the God Vishwakarma regarded as the inventor of this word is observed as Vishwakarma Puja in India. It is an auspicious day in Hinduism. The people belonging to the artisans and craftsman group celebrate this festival with great joy.

 

Vishwakarma Puja- A tribute to the divine architect

The celebration of the festival of Vishwakarma Puja is done every year to memorize and pay our tribute to God for this beautiful creation. His beautiful creations include the holy palace Dwarka, Indraprastha, the entire world, vehicles, and weapons of different gods. He is referred to as a divine carpenter in Rig Veda. It is believed that he had been gifted with the science of mechanics and architecture.

 

Commemoration of Vishwakarma Puja

Vishwakarma Puja is usually celebrated at the end of Bhado month according to the Hindu calendar. The day is marked as a public holiday by the government. All the small-scale industries, shops, and factories are cleaned and whitewashed before the occasion. They are closed for working on the day of Vishwakarma Puja. The people decorate it with lights, flowers, and garlands. The idol of God Vishwakarma is kept and decorated with flowers. People offer their prayers and worship their tools. They ask God to bless them with innovation and success in their work. 

Vishwakarma Puja is an important Hindu festival that is celebrated by the people of India and Nepal. The festival is of great significance for people having industrial or craftsman backgrounds. The festival is observed every year in the mid of September according to the Gregorian calendar. People in the entire nation celebrate this festival with great pomp and show.
 

Significance of celebrating Vishwakarma Puja

Every festival that is celebrated in the nation has some significance behind its celebration. Vishwakarma Puja is celebrated to honor the work of God Vishwakarma. The entire universe is believed to be the creation of God Vishwakarma. He was very good at his work and therefore regarded as a divine carpenter in Rig Veda. He is also an exemplar for the people working as architects, engineers, craftsmen, mechanics, smiths, welders, industrial workers, etc. His notable deeds inspire people of these communities to work harder and get successful in their work.

 

Customs in celebrating Vishwakarma Puja

The small-scale factories, shops, and industries are closed on the day of Vishwakarma Puja. People clean their houses as well as the working places. The Puja is generally initiated by a morning arti in the morning. The rituals are performed on the ground floor. The idol of God Vishwakarma is placed and is beautifully decorated with flowers and garlands. The tools are also placed for worship. The people worship and offer their prayers to God. They pray to God Vishwakarma to bless them with innovation, work potential, and success in their work. The Prasad is distributed among all after the prayer is performed. Several delicious food items are prepared by the people and are served in the grand feast organized by them during the night. The festival spreads love, joy and encourages people to do their work with sincerity.

Few Lines on Importance of Vishwakarma Puja??

Vishwakarma Jayanti is a day of celebration for Vishwakarma, a Hindu god, the divine architect. He is considered as swayambhu and creator of the world. He constructed the holy city of Dwarka where Krishna ruled, the palace of Indraprastha for the Pandavas, and was the creator of many fabulous weapons for the gods. He is also called the divine carpenter, is mentioned in the Rig Veda, and is credited with Sthapatya Veda, the science of mechanics and architecture.
